Hospital wins NIH pediatric rheumatology training grant
October 9th, 2005
Children's Hospital of Pittsburgh's (Pennsylvania) rheumatology division received one of only two U.S. National Institutes of Health (NIH) training grants and states it is recognized as one of the foremost programs devoted to children with rheumatic diseases in the United States. Children's was awarded a 5-year grant from the NIH to train fellows in pediatric rheumatology. Under the leadership of Raphael Hirsch, MD, division chief of pediatric rheumatology at Children's, the program will receive funding for training four fellows a year (two second-year fellows and two third-year fellows).
